How much do part time html & css j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 22, 2026, the average yearly pay for part time html & css in the United States is $79,649.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$43,000.00 and $104,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a Part Time Html & Css job?

A Part Time HTML & CSS job involves designing and developing web pages using HTML for structure and CSS for styling. These roles are typically flexible, allowing individuals to work fewer hours compared to full-time positions. Responsibilities may include updating websites, creating responsive designs, and ensuring cross-browser compatibility. Part-time HTML & CSS jobs are ideal for freelancers, students, or professionals looking for additional work.

What are typical daily tasks for a Part Time HTML & CSS position?

In a Part Time HTML & CSS role, your daily tasks often include coding and updating web pages, ensuring designs are responsive across devices, and collaborating with designers or other developers to implement website changes. You might also review and troubleshoot code to resolve layout issues or inconsistencies. Depending on the team structure, you may provide input on improving user experience or assist with basic content updates. These responsibilities help ensure websites run smoothly and look professional, even when working flexible or limited hours.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Part Time Html & Css position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Part Time HTML & CSS professional, you need strong foundational skills in writing clean, semantic HTML and CSS for building and styling user interfaces. Familiarity with basic web development tools like code editors (e.g., VS Code), version control systems (such as Git), and understanding of responsive design principles is often expected. Attention to detail, effective communication, and the ability to collaborate remotely are valuable soft skills in this role. These abilities are important for creating visually appealing, accessible, and well-structured websites that meet client or team requirements.

Job description

Mentor enthusiastic students as they learn JavaScript, jQuery, Git, HTML, CSS and related skills. Our students are building programming skills to better their careers and develop personal projects; your role is to be their hero and help them sharpen their skills as they work through our curriculum and achieve their goals. Some will get promoted, others will get a new job, while others will just learn for the fun of it.
Thinkful mentors may work remotely or from our office. This is a part-time position, with the potential to grow with the company, if that's your thing.
RESPONSIBILITIES:
  • Mentor students enrolled in our Front End Web Dev course as they work through a project-based curriculum.
  • Lead weekly 1-on-1 sessions where you'll answer student questions, review and provide feedback on student code and projects, and and guide students through the course.
  • Participate in student communities to provide advice and review.
  • Foster a sense of excitement in your students and guide them through the pitfalls of becoming a front end developer.

REQUIREMENTS:
  • Demonstrated expertise in front end web development.
  • Command of HTML, CSS, JavaScript, jQuery, Git and related technologies.
  • Powerful communication skills, with the ability to concisely explain new, complicated subjects to beginners and experts.
  • Strong interest in the future of online learning and career education.
  • Infectious enthusiasm for learning new technologies.
  • Self-directed, with an ability to mentor students with minimal oversight.
